Attenuated familial adenomatous polyposis and Muir-Torre syndrome linked to compound biallelic constitutional MYH gene mutations.Peculiar dermatologic manifestations are present in several heritable gastrointestinal disorders. Muir-Torre syndrome (MTS) is a genodermatosis whose peculiar feature is the presence of sebaceous gland tumors associated with visceral malignancies. We describe one patient in whom multiple sebaceous gland tumors were associated with early onset colon and thyroid cancers and attenuated polyposis coli. Her family history was positive for colonic adenomas. She had a daughter presenting with yellow papules in the forehead region developed in the late infancy. Skin and visceral neoplasms were tested for microsatellite instability and immunohistochemical status of mismatch repair (MMR), APC and MYH proteins. The proband colon and skin tumors were microsatellite stable and showed normal expression of MMR proteins. Cytoplasmic expression of MYH protein was revealed in colonic cancer cells. Compound heterozygosity due to biallelic mutations in MYH, R168H and 379delC, was identified in the proband. The 11-year-old daughter was carrier of the monoallelic constitutional mutation 379delC in the MYH gene; in the sister, the R168H MYH gene mutation was detected. This report presents an interesting case of association between MYH-associated polyposis and sebaceous gland tumors. These findings suggest that patients with MTS phenotype that include colonic polyposis should be screened for MYH gene mutations.

与复合双等位基因遗传性MYH基因突变相关的attenuated家族性腺瘤性息肉病和穆尔-托综合征。几种遗传性胃肠道疾病存在特殊的皮肤表现。穆尔-托综合征(MTS)是一种遗传性皮肤病,其独特特征是存在与内脏恶性肿瘤相关的皮脂腺肿瘤。我们描述了一名患者,其多个皮脂腺肿瘤与早发性结肠癌、甲状腺癌以及attenuated息肉病相关。她的家族史中结肠腺瘤呈阳性。她有一个女儿,在婴儿晚期前额区域出现黄色丘疹。对皮肤和内脏肿瘤进行了微卫星不稳定性以及错配修复(MMR)、APC和MYH蛋白的免疫组化检测。先证者的结肠癌和皮肤肿瘤微卫星稳定,MMR蛋白表达正常。在结肠癌细胞中发现了MYH蛋白的细胞质表达。在先证者中鉴定出由于MYH基因双等位基因突变R168H和379delC导致的复合杂合性。11岁的女儿是MYH基因单等位基因遗传性突变379delC的携带者;在其姐妹中,检测到R168H MYH基因突变。本报告介绍了一例MYH相关息肉病与皮脂腺肿瘤关联的有趣病例。这些发现表明,对于具有包括结肠息肉病在内的MTS表型的患者,应筛查MYH基因突变。
